Complaint Investigation Report
The investigation revealed the following:
In regards to the allegation: “Facility staff are now allowing client access to different areas of the home .” It is alleged that a staff did not allow C1 to go to work and was told to stay in her room. (5) out of (5) staff interviewed denied the allegation. Staff members indicated that clients are free to do what they want and they can go in and out of the facility whenever they want as this is their home. Staff interviewed stated that they receive in service training regarding clients' rights, abuse and zero tolerance policy on a regular basis. (3) out of (5) staff interviewed stated that C1 complained about a foot injury and was examined by a physician on 03/17/2025, who recommended C1 to stay home for 2 days to prevent further injury. All staff interviewed also stated that no one has told clients to stay in their room and not to go out for no reason as that will be a violation of the clients' rights. Interview with SC revealed that San Gabriel Pomona Regional Center has investigated this allegation on 03/20/2025 and found no issues to be concerned about. (4) out of (5) clients interviewed denied the allegation and indicated that staff allow them to do what they want in the facility and can come and go at their convenience. Based on record reviews, no staff members in the facility faced disciplinary measures for violating clients' rights. Interviewed clients also stated that they consider the facility their home and feel safe. Therefore, there was insufficient evidence to corroborate with this allegation.
In regards to the allegation: “Facility staff do not treat client with dignity and respect.” It is alleged that a staff was yelling at C1, making C1 stay in her room for 2 days and C1 cannot come out for any reason. (5) out of (5) staff interviewed denied the allegation and stated that they treat all clients with respect and never yelled at anyone. Staff interviewed stated that they receive in service training regarding clients' rights, abuse and zero tolerance policy on a regular basis. All staff interviewed also stated that no one has told the clients to stay in their room and not come out for any reason. Interview with SC revealed that San Gabriel Pomona Regional Center has investigated this allegation on 03/20/2025 and found no issues to be concerned about. (4) out of (5) clients interviewed denied the allegation and indicated that staff interact and treat them with dignity and respect. Interviewed clients also stated that none of the staff have ever made them do anything against their will nor yelled at them. During the visit, LPA observed staff speaking with clients respectfully and not being loud or speaking in loud voices. Therefore, there was insufficient evidence to corroborate with this allegation.
Based on statements and interviews conducted with staff, clients, review of facility file records, there was not enough supportive evidence to concur with the reported allegations. Although the allegations may have happened or are valid, there is not a preponderance of evidence to prove the alleged violations did or did not occur, therefore the allegations are UNSUBSTANTIATED.
